Access Denied

You don't have permission to access "http://www.autowereld.nl/opel/astra-gtc/1-4-turbo-sport-150pk-pdc-navi-xenon-opc-line-29522246/foto.html?" on this server.

Reference #18.acc83017.1711670559.f63a142

https://errors.edgesuite.net/18.acc83017.1711670559.f63a142